Output 20ed37a6ae2bf3674a987eee32415f0817f5ce79c7faf7ad4a8ce4dc986d87fc:1

value
136154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 284cb24b42ad039895e69920bef28b1023318f26 OP_EQUALVERIFY OP_CHECKSIG
address
14g5udvzzwEVfAozGugaXUeFZ5NK93iwSZ
transaction
20ed37a6ae2bf3674a987eee32415f0817f5ce79c7faf7ad4a8ce4dc986d87fc
confirmations
302449
spent
true